Obituary for Kenneth Wayne Punneo

Kenneth Wayne  Punneo
Services to celebrate his life will be 11:00 AM Saturday, Jan. 7, 2017 at the funeral home.


Viewing will be 4-8 PM Thursday & Friday at the funeral home with family to greet friends Friday 6-8 PM.


Kenneth Wayne Punneo passed away suddenly on Tuesday, January 3, 2017 at the age of 61. He was born on November 21, 1955 in Anadarko, Oklahoma to his parents, Raymond Kenneth and Shirley A. (Lumpkin) Punneo. In 1974, Kenneth graduated from Cyril High School, where he ran track and played football. Following his high school graduation, Kenneth went to work at RexAm, where he worked as a printer operator. Kenneth worked for RexAm for 35 years until they closed. Kenneth loved OU, the OKC Thunder and played bass in the band Clear Creek, but what he truly loved was time spent with his family. He was a wonderful son, doting father, loving brother, and loyal friend who will be deeply missed.

He was preceded in death by his:
Father, Raymond Kenneth Punneo;
Brother, Keith Punneo.

He leaves behind cherished memories with his loving:
Mother, Shirley Crawford and step-father Cecil;
Son, Joey Punneo and his wife, Andrea;
Son, Eric Punneo;
Grandchildren: Bailey Punneo and Bryson Punneo;
Many other loving family and friends.
